Abstract:In order to objectively reflecting the feature of seismic wavefield in fractured reservoir,the paper,on the basis of predecessors' studies,presented a new numeric simulation method of fractured reservoir-Micro Vector and Macro Scale (MIVMAS).The method comprehensively considers the physical properties of fractures and surrounding materials in fracture-developed zones and uses micro Christoff vector equations to compute P-wave-equivalent velocity in each fracture-developed zone,which obtains new velocity model and the model of reflection coefficients; then,using numeric simulation method of wave equation,the numeric simulation of new model is carried out by macro scalar wave equation.Taking the whole feature of fracture zone as studied target,the results of numeric simulation obtained by the method are more consistent with reality,which provides a new idea and method for study of wavefield feature in fractured reservoirs.
